Breneisen Named Recycling Markets Program Manager

The Pennsylvania Recycling Markets Center announced this week that Timothy J. Breneisen will join the RMC Team effective July 16 as the Recycling Program Manager.

Tim has 29 years experience in the environmental profession including 18 years as the Recycling Coordinator for the Lancaster County Solid Waste Management Authority. He has been involved with development and direction of over 40 municipal curbside recycling programs, marketing approximately 9,000 tons of recyclable materials annually.

Tim is also a past president, vice-president, and secretary of the Professional Recyclers of Pennsylvania and is active on several state committees, including the award winning Certified Recycling Professional Program Committee.

The Pennsylvania Recycling Markets Center is a non-profit organization charged with reducing barriers to development of markets for recyclable materials in the Commonwealth.
